Letty Craydon (1899-2 November 1965) was an Australian actress who performed on stage, radio, television and in films. She was also an author.[1] Craydon made her professional debut aged six months old. She said she specialised in the "mop and bucket act".[2]
She was married to Ron Shand.[3] Craydon died in 1965 after a short illness.[4]
